If you’re a regular reader of MLB Trade Rumors, you know that players are designated for assignment almost every day. Those players can sometimes end up on another team, via a trade or waivers or free agency. A lot of the time, those transactions don’t prove to be significant.

The following players were designated for assignment in February of 2026: Drew Romo, Jairo Iriarte, Weston Wilson, Ken Waldichuk, Cody Laweryson, Víctor Mesa Jr, Andy Ibáñez, Ben Rortvedt (twice), Dom Hamel, Bryan Hudson, George Soriano, Braden Shewmake, Brett Wisely, Anthony Banda, Kaleb Ort, Max Schuemann, Yanquiel Fernández, Mitch Spence, Grant Holman, Jackson Kowar, Josh Simpson, Zak Kent (twice), Ben Cowles, Bryan Ramos, Jack Suwinski and Tirso Ornelas.

Most of those players haven’t been huge factors this season. Only three of those pitchers have logged at least 17 innings in the big leagues this year. Two of those, Banda and Soriano, had mid-4.00s ERAs. Hudson is the only one to really have a strong season and he ended up back with his original team. After his DFA, the White Sox traded him to the Mets but then got him back via waivers in March.

Among the position players, the impacts have also mostly been minor. Some of those guys didn’t even crack the majors this year. Schuemann, Romo, Shewmake, Rortvedt, Wilson and Ibáñez combined for 604 plate appearances, a .189/.267/.318 batting line, 67 wRC+ and -0.8 wins above replacement, according to FanGraphs.

The major exception has been Mesa. The Marlins designated him for assignment in early February when they claimed right-hander Garrett Acton off waivers from the Rockies. A few days later, Mesa was traded to the Rays for minor league infielder Angel Brachi. That deal has worked out far better for one of the two Florida clubs than the other.
